Iti Tyagi, the founder of Craft Village, a Delhi-based social organisation that trains and promotes craftsmen and iconic craft heritage, has been helping artisans to directly supply craft items to businesses around the world. She also organises the annual India Craft Week. This year’s event is significant as the pandemic has wiped out the livelihoods of artisans and they have great hopes the event will help them earn some money, Tyagi tells Varuni Khosla in an interview.
